Understanding Dementia

Global overview

  • Over 55 million people worldwide are living with dementia.
  • Nearly 80% of people with dementia will display changes in behaviour at some point.
  • These changes are expressions of unmet needs, distress, or disorientation - not simply “behaviour problems."
  • Supporting staff to understand the person’s feelings and triggers can reduce reliance on medicines or physical restraints.
  • With skilled, compassionate behavioural support, hospital visits decline, and pressure on health systems is eased.
  • Helping people feel safe, seen, and emotionally supported is central to effective care.
